ABOUT THE DEPARTMENT

From its earliest days the City of Rancho Cucamonga was dubbed the City with a Plan over the past forty years we have been creating a world-class late 2021 the City adopted an updated General Plan that clarified the vision for the Citys next chapter and an idea that has been simmering for over a decade: that the city can grow providing new housing and economic opportunities and position itself for the next generation economy while maintaining its wonderful single-family neighborhoods by focusing new growth onto key corridors and into key nodes.

The Planning Department plays a critical role in achieving the City Councils goals and objectives relative to land use urban design and the quality and sustainability of the built environment. The department focuses on development that enhances economic value and opportunities for prosperity and quality of life for all. We work with residents business owners developers and elected officials to build a shared vision for the citys futurefostering both short-term responsiveness and long-term resilience.

Beyond managing individual development proposals we focus on creatingplaces not just projectsthinking holistically about how buildings streets public spaces and natural systems come together to shape the daily lives of people. We believe that thoughtful people-centered planning can create inclusive vibrant and memorable places that foster connection identity and pride.

We lead long-range planning initiatives that address housing transportation economic development environmental sustainability and climate resilience. The department also collects and analyzes data to support policy decisions and ensure equitable growth and development. Through public engagement and cross-departmental coordination we strive to create livable neighborhoods and meaningful public spaces that reflect the values and aspirations of the community.

Ultimately our goal is development for people firstbuilding a quality place that attracts and retains residents visitors businesses and talent while preserving the character and heritage of our city.

WHAT YOU WILL BE DOING HERE AT TEAM RC

As anAssistant Planner you will play an important role in supporting the Citys planning efforts by assisting with both current development projects and long-range planning initiatives that emphasize people-centered growth. Working under the guidance of senior planning staff you will review development proposals research zoning and land use regulations draft staff reports conduct research and analysis and participate in public meetings. Through these efforts you will contribute to ensuring that development aligns with the Citys goals to enhance economic opportunity improve quality of life and reflect the vision outlined in the General Plan.

This position includes regular interaction with the public at the planning counter and through phone and email inquiries. The Assistant Planner will provide clear professional customer service by answering general questions assisting with application intake and helping customers understand planning processes and requirements while working closely with senior staff to address more complex issues.

As an Assistant Planner you will be responsible for:

  • Lead planning and development review projects including routine or less complex applications to ensure consistency with the General Plan zoning code and local policies
  • Respond to inquiries from applicants property owners and community members regarding planning processes and requirements providing courteous accurate and timely customer service at the public planning counter by phone and via email
  • Assisting with long-range and policy planning efforts including specific plans zoning updates and housing initiatives
  • Conducting research and analysis to support land use decisions and policy development
  • Participating in public meetings workshops and community engagement activities
  • Collaborating with other departments to support coordinated planning efforts
  • Learning and staying informed about planning practices zoning regulations and environmental review requirements
